    Cylinder leakdown higher after engine rebuild?

    Hey all,

    some of you may remember my post regarding my oil light coming on after reaching operating temp, however when I would check the oil level after shutdown, it was only slightly below the max mark once all oil drained back to the pan. During my investigations, I saw a noticeable amount of metallic material in the oil filter housing, so I thought maybe the oil filter was getting a little over worked, so even though only at 1300 miles on the oil, I decided to change the oil.

    Quick back story: this engine was fully rebuilt just under 3k miles ago, New main and rod bearing, CP pistons w/ rings, all machine work done by lang racing. First oil interval was 1200 miles with 15w-50 conventional break in oil, then 1300 on 10w-60, that oil last 1300 run was the oil I had just drained in the above statement.

    Ok, so the reason I rebuilt the motor was due to oil consumption. After doing a leakdown test prior to the rebuild my results were
    Cylinder 1: 3% heard at oil cap
    Cylinder 2: 4% heard at oil cap
    Cylinder 3: 2% heard at oil cap
    Cylinder 4: 2% heard at oil cap
    Cylinder 5: 3.5% heard at oil cap
    Cylinder 6: 3.5% heard at oil cap

    I figured this wasn’t really abnormal and concluded the consumption must have been from valve seals. Had the motor rebuilt, and here we are back at the current situation. When I saw all the metallic material in the OFH, I decided to drain it and take an oil sample like i always do. The report came back stating,

    “The oil filter clogging can be a reason for the low oil light, but we wouldn't rule out oil
    consumption due to a cylinder-area issue. Chrome (piston rings) and iron (cylinders and other steel parts)
    nearly doubled after a similar run as last time. Increasing oil consumption is a common symptom of a
    ring/cylinder-area issue. Ticking can be another. You might consider a compression or leak down test due
    to the wear. The other wear metals look okay, overall, but now aluminum (pistons) is reading at its highest
    level”

    I did a leakdown test yesterday, and my results were all consistently higher than before:
    Cylinder 1: 4%
    Cylinder 2: 5%
    Cylinder 3: 6%
    Cylinder 4: 5%
    Cylinder 5: 5%
    Cylinder 6: 5% All cylinders heard at oil cap.

    My question: How long do piston rings take to seat? Do you think those materials in the oil are normal for a new motor with less than 3k miles? Or do you think I actually have a ring issue, in which case I’m screwed, bc as good as everyone says he is, I highly doubt lang will stand behind any of their work as their website states zero warranty on any work they do.
